Late Score Lifts Tulsa Over South Florida 32-31

10/16/2021 5:24:00 PM | Football

Shamari Brooks scores TD with 0:42 on the clock


GAME BOOK  I  POST-GAME NOTES  I  PHOTO GALLERY 

TAMPA, Fla. ––
Shamari Brooks' three-yard touchdown run with less than one minute in the game lifted Tulsa to a 32-31 comeback victory over South Florida on Saturday afternoon at Raymond James Stadium.
 
Tulsa overcame three offensive turnovers, a special teams touchdown by the Bulls and a double-digit deficit for the win. The final 0:47 of the game was the only time Tulsa led in posting its third comeback victory of the season.
 
The Hurricane improved to 3-4 overall and 2-1 in American Athletic Conference action, while USF fell to 1-5 and 0-2 in league play.
 
With 4:20 remaining in the game, Tulsa took over possession at the USF 42-yard line after the Hurricane defense held the Bulls on 4th-and-1. Tulsa had its own fourth down situation on 4th-and-3 from the USF 20-yard line, but Davis Brin completed a 6-yard pass to Josh Johnson for the first down. Brooks then took over, gaining five yards and six yards on the next two plays before scoring from three yards out for the game-winning touchdown.
 
Brooks finished with 145 yards and Deneric Prince added 110 yards on the ground for the Hurricane. Tulsa ended the game with a whopping 535 to 268-yard edge in total offense, while the Hurricane defense also held USF to 17 offensive points. The Bulls added a pick-6 and a 61-yard punt return for scores.
 
Despite two first-half interceptions, Brin completed 22-of-39 passes for 266 yards and two touchdowns.
 
Without defensive starters – end Cullen Wick, and safeties Cristian Williams and Kendarin Ray – the Tulsa defense put in another solid performance, holding the Bulls to 113 rushing and 155 passing yards. Defensively, Justin Wright had a team-best seven tackles and a season-high 2.5 sacks for -9 yards, while Tyon Davis had a team-high three pass breakups.
 
After putting up 319 yards of total offense in the first half, Tulsa managed just 44 yards in the third quarter as South Florida built a 31-20 lead after three quarters. In the fourth quarter, Tulsa scored two touchdowns and gained 172 yards on 24 plays while the Hurricane defense held the Bulls to just 32 yards on 12 carries in the final 15 minutes.
 
USF scored the only points of the third quarter to take an 11-point lead, 31-20, with 4:30 remaining in the period. USF's Tim McClain took an 8-yard quarterback keeper for the score to cap the 10-play, 81-yard drive.
 
Tulsa got on the board for the first time in the second half when the Hurricane took its first fourth quarter possession 99 yards in 10 plays. Brin threw the final 13 yards to Josh Johnson for the touchdown, but failed on the two-point conversion, making the score 31-26.
 
Tulsa had to punt on its next possession after getting to the 50-yard line, and then that's where the Hurricane defense held on 4th-and-1 to give the offense the ball for the winning drive.
 
To start the game, South Florida took the opening kickoff 48 yards in eight plays and settled for a 44-yard field goal to toa an early 3-0 lead.
 
The Hurricane marched to the USF four-yard line and settled for a 22-yard field goal to tie the score at 3-3 with 4:54 left in the first period, capping a 71-yard, 15-play drive. A scoring run by Brin that would have given Tulsa the lead was nullified due to a holding call on the first Hurricane possession.
 
A fake field goal by the Bulls on their next possession from the Tulsa 34-yard line was stopped by Tulsa's Davis to close out the first quarter.
 
A Tulsa fumble, only the second lost on the season for the Hurricane, gave USF the ball at the 12-yard line and four plays later Jaren Mangham put the Bulls ahead 10-3 after the PAT on a one-yard score.
 
The Hurricane took the subsequent possession to the USF 24-yard line but on a 3rd-and-9 play, Tulsa committed its second turnover in an as many possessions on an interception by the Bulls' Dwayne Boyles.
 
Tulsa's defense held USF on three plays, forcing a punt, and the Hurricane offense took possession at the USF 43-yard line. Prince carried three times for 24 yards, including the final one-yard touchdown run for a 4-play, 43-yard drive to tie the score at 10-10.
 
But, USF wasted no time with a 100-yard kickoff return to retake the lead at 17-10. USF added to its lead when Tulsa had its third turnover of the half, an interception that was returned for a touchdown by the Bulls' Antonio Grier for a 24-10 lead with just 5:54 left in the first half.
 
On the subsequent possession, Tulsa had to settle for another field goal, a 25-yarder by Long, capping a 68-yard, 12-play drive and making the score 24-13 with 1:10 left in the first half.
 
On the kickoff, the Hurricane special teams made a play when Tyree Carlisle forced a fumble that was recovered by Hunter Rangel at the USF 37-yard line. On the first play, Brin connected with Sam Crawford Jr. on a 37-yard strike to make the score 24-20 with just 0:57 remaining before halftime.
 
It was an exciting and unusual first half as the teams combined for 38 second quarter points after just six points in the first period. USF had two of their scores come on special teams and defense, while Tulsa's first takeaway cut its first-half deficit to four points.
 
At the intermission, Tulsa held a 319 to 128-yard advantage in total offense. The Hurricane gained 153 rushing yards and 166 yards through the air.
